Bunk Beds For Kids - Are They Safe?

7-beds-in-1-happy-beds-max-combination-dove-grey-bed-bunk-bed-mid-sleeper-daybed-midsleeper-and-single-bed-toddler-bed-3ft-single-90-x-190cm-frame-246.jpgBunk beds offer kids an exciting way to save space and also add an element of adventure to their bedroom. But, it's crucial to consider safety features before buying a bed.

It is generally recommended that children wait until they reach the age of six before utilizing a best childrens bunk beds bed.

They help save space

In the present, a lot of families live in tight spaces. Space-saving solutions can be used in a city-based apartment, an idyllic cottage or even if you wish to maximize every square inch. Bunk beds are the ultimate room-saving device that provide a comfortable sleeping solution that saves on floor space while fostering creativity and encouraging organization.

The primary benefit of bunk beds is that they can stack two beds in a row, which makes efficient use of vertical space. This is particularly useful in rooms with low-ceilings, where space is restricted. Beds can also provide an experience for children by providing them with the comfort of a cozy space to play in and spark their imagination.

The most effective options for bunk beds are stairs or steps that take you to the top of the bed. This is safer for children who may not have the coordination to climb up. This eliminates the need for a separate ladder and make it easier for older siblings and parents to help children climb safely into bed.

Bunk beds may also come with storage built-in that can help kids keep their rooms organised and free of clutter. Some bunk bed for kids beds are equipped with desks or bookshelves, which make them a perfect place for children to study and learn.

If you choose bunk beds with trundles, which can be pulled out and used as a single bed if needed It's also a great option for sleepovers. You don't have to worry about occupying valuable floor space with the camp bed or a spare mattress. Your children can also invite their friends to a party without any hassle.

Bunks are also a great creative canvas for kids who may want to personalise them with fairy lights or hanging decals to create their own unique sleeping space. Remember to follow safety standards and install guardrails on the top bunk. Also, be sure that you strictly adhere to the weight limits.

They Encourage Independence

Children are usually thrilled when they are given bunk beds. It's a chance to rest under the stars, invite friends over for sleepovers or call dibs on a top bed. Bunk beds can be used as a playground, a fort or a place to study. It's no wonder that kids have been enjoying these stylish, space-saving beds for centuries.

When you are choosing a bunk bed for your kids, there are some things to consider. It's important to first take into account your child's age and maturity. Experts are of the opinion that children younger than six years old are not ready to sleep in the upper bunk of the bunk bed because of their lack of spatial awareness and coordination. It's also important to note that children who tend to sleepwalk or roll over during their sleep should be assigned the lowest bunk.

Whether your child is suited to climb up the stairs or not, it's crucial to teach them how to use the ladder in a safe and proper manner to be able to climb up and down easily. This is an important life skill that they'll learn and practice throughout their lives. Bunk beds can also encourage the sense of independence and responsibility in children, as they will be responsible to keep the space they are living in tidy, neat, and clutter-free.

Another thing to keep in mind is to select bunk beds that are free from toxic chemicals and formaldehyde. You can reduce the toxicity by choosing beds made with non-toxic materials, such as solid wood, and non-toxic stain and paints. You should also avoid any bed that uses plywood, particle board or fiberboard, since these can release formaldehyde in the air. This is a known carcinogen that can irritate your throat, nose, and respiratory tract.

You're safe

Bunk beds can save space and allow kids more space to play. But some parents worry that bunk beds are unsafe for children. The answer: it is all dependent on the safety features you pick.

You'll need to select bunk beds constructed of durable materials that can withstand your child's weight. Solid wood or metal frames are typically the safest alternatives for bunk beds for children. Make sure that the ladder is safe and sturdy and that the rails on the top bunk are secured. You can even opt for an option that has stairs instead of a ladder which eliminates the need for an actual ladder and gives modern, sleek style to your kid's bedroom.

Ganjian, a pediatrician, says bunk beds for children are generally safe for children. However, it's important to take into account your child's maturity and age in deciding when they're ready to move up to the top bunk. He suggests waiting until kids are eight or six before they move to the top bunk.

Other safety concerns when it comes to bunk beds include ensuring that the mattress fits securely against the frame and that there aren't any gaps or holes in which children could climb. It is a good idea to stop children from playing on the bunk bed or around it, and also from hanging things like decor or jump ropes from the top bunk.

Although it might seem odd it is true that a bunk bed can actually be safer than a standard single bed due to the fact that the mattress at the bottom is more in line with the floor and less likely to fall out of the bed. You'll want to make sure that the mattress you select for your child's bunk is of high quality and is the right size.
